BBC Radio Northampton's Chris Egerton at Old Trafford

David Smith's comments on the Old Trafford pitch have livened things up off the field while his players battle on against the odds. The Northants chief executive told BBC Radio Northampton "the pitch looked underprepared and the scorecard supports this view". But ECB pitch inspector Jack Birkenshaw has confirmed he will take no action over the pitch, saying consistent bowling and poor batting has contributed to the state of the match, which could well be completed inside two days.
